--- Quote from: MadMax on February 07, 2016, 07:28:04 AM ---Sorry, my fault. I have 1.0.6 on my laptop.  ::) What's the easiest way to upgrade from 1.x to 2.x without losing settings, files and stuff?

--- End quote ---
To be safe:

Backup your important personal files onto either a separate partition or a USB stick (Note: this is not needed if you set up your system with a separate soft-linked DATA partition as an update should not touch this).

To keep your program settings: backup your hidden files from your home directory to a separate partition or a USB stick. Be aware, however, that newer versions of some programs might have changed their settings options and your old settings might not work with the newer versions!!

For things like custom fonts, themes, icons, etc: you need to back them up as well to be on the safe side.

As far as your "stuff" goes -- that's your choice.  ;D

I believe this answer to your question is you cannot upgrade from 1.0.6 to the LL 2.x series.

Here's the part of the 2.8 release anouncement (the first post in this thread) that I'm referring to:

Upgrading:

For those on Linux Lite 2.4, 2.6 do the following:

1) Menu, Favorites, Install Updates.
2) Menu, Settings, Lite Upgrade.
3) Follow the onscreen instructions, reboot when finished.

For those on versions of Linux Lite 2.0, 2.2 only, do the following:

Open a terminal and do:

Code:

sudo apt-get update && sudo apt-get install lite-upgrade-series2 -y


2) Menu, Settings, Lite Upgrade.
3) Follow the onscreen instructions, reboot when finished.

You cannot upgrade from Linux Lite 1.0.0, 1.0.2, 1.0.4, 1.0.6, 1.0.8
